Download if you dare: iOS 9 public beta is here

Apple releases public previews of its mobile and desktop operating systems, Facebook gives you more News Feed controls, and Meerkat makes big changes to challenge Periscope.

Adventurous Apple users, your public beta updates have arrived.

Apple released public beta versions of the upcoming operating systems for iPhones, iPads and Mac computers. It's the first time Apple has released a major update to the public under beta. (Before, only developers had access.) But if you want to take an early peek, be prepared for bugs:
